How to Measure a Room for Furniture (Without Making Costly Mistakes)
The tape measure is the most powerful tool in interior design. Failing to measure accurately is the primary reason why online furniture purchases end in frustrating, expensive returns. Measuring a room is not just about finding the length and width of the floor; it is about mapping a three-dimensional space, accounting for obstacles, and ensuring the piece can actually make it through the front door.
Why Most People Measure Wrong
The amateur approach to measuring a room goes like this: stretch a tape measure across the wall where the sofa will go, look at the sofa's width online, and click "buy."
This method ignores depth, height, walking clearances, window sills, radiators, and door swings. A room is a complex, active environment. To furnish it correctly, you must create a comprehensive dimensional map of the space. Here is the professional, step-by-step framework for measuring a room.
Step 1: Gather Your Tools
You cannot do this properly with a 12-inch ruler or a sewing tape. You need:
- A 25-foot steel tape measure (stiff enough to stay straight across a room).
- Graph paper (essential for drawing to scale).
- A pencil with an eraser (you will make mistakes).
- Optional but highly recommended: A laser distance measurer. These cost about $30 online and provide instant, laser-accurate wall-to-wall measurements without needing a second person to hold the other end of the tape.
Step 2: Create the Baseline Perimeter Map
Start by drawing a rough outline of the room's shape on your graph paper. Do not worry about scale just yet.
Pick one corner of the room and work your way around clockwise, measuring along the baseboards. Write down the length of every single wall segment. Measure wall-to-wall, not corner-to-furniture. If there is an alcove or a bump-out, measure every individual side of it.
Crucial Tip: Always measure twice. It is remarkably easy to misread 72 inches as 62 inches on a metal tape measure. Write the measurements in inches (e.g., 144") rather than feet and inches (12'0") to make comparing with online furniture specs easier.
Step 3: Map the Obstacles (The 3D Elements)
A room is not an empty box. Once you have the perimeter, you must measure the fixed architectural elements that will dictate where furniture can and cannot go.
- Windows: Measure the width of the window (including the frame). More importantly, measure the height from the floor to the bottom of the window sill. If you buy a sofa with a 36-inch high back, but your window sill starts at 28 inches, the sofa will awkwardly block the glass.
- Doors and Walkways: Measure the width of the door frame. Then, open the door and map the "door swing arc." You cannot place furniture inside this arc, or the door will hit it every time it opens.
- Outlets and Switches: Mark the location of every electrical outlet and light switch on your map. A beautifully placed media console is useless if it blocks the only outlet you need to plug in the television.
- Heating and Cooling: Note the location of floor vents, baseboard heaters, and wall radiators. Blocking a return vent with a heavy bookshelf can severely impact your home's HVAC efficiency.
Step 4: Measure the Vertical Space (Ceiling Height)
Do not assume you have standard 8-foot ceilings. Measure from the floor to the ceiling in a few different spots (especially in older homes where floors may settle).
Vertical measurements are critical for tall items like bookshelves, armoires, canopy beds, and large artwork. You need at least a few inches of clearance between the top of a piece of furniture and the ceiling to allow for assembly (you often have to tilt a tall piece upright) and to prevent the room from feeling suffocated.
Step 5: The "Will It Fit in the House?" Test (Delivery Path)
This is the step that causes 90% of delivery nightmares. It does not matter if a king-size bed fits perfectly in the master bedroom if you cannot get it up the stairs. Before buying large, rigid items (sofas, dressers, dining tables), you must measure the "Delivery Path."
- Exterior Doors: Measure the height and width of the door frame (inside the jambs).
- Hallways: Measure the narrowest point of any hallway the delivery team must pass through. Check for low-hanging light fixtures.
- Staircases: Measure the width of the stairs. If the stairs have a landing where they turn 90 or 180 degrees, measure the depth and width of the landing, and the distance from the landing floor to the ceiling. Tight turns are the enemy of large sofas.
- Elevators: If you live in an apartment, measure the open elevator door width, and the interior height, width, and depth of the cab.
Compare these delivery path measurements against the furniture's packaged dimensions. If the retailer provides a "diagonal depth" measurement, this is the crucial number for fitting items through doorways.
Step 6: Translating to Scale
Now that you have all your numbers, you can redraw your room to scale on graph paper. A common scale is 1 square = 1 foot (or 1/4 inch = 1 foot). You can then cut out little scaled rectangles of paper representing the furniture you want to buy and move them around the map.
Ensure you leave appropriate clearances: 30-36 inches for major walkways, 14-18 inches between a coffee table and sofa, and 36 inches behind dining chairs.
The Shortcoming of the Manual Method
While meticulous measuring and graphing is highly effective for ensuring physical fit, it has one major flaw: it does not tell you what the room will actually look like.
A paper rectangle cannot show you visual weight. It cannot show you how the height of the sofa arms interacts with the coffee table. It cannot show you if the room feels claustrophobic, even if the math says the furniture fits.
